Why are halogens coloured?

Why are all halogens coloured?

लघु उत्तरीय
Advertisements

उत्तर

Almost all halogens are coloured. This is because halogens absorb radiation in the visible region. This results in the excitation of valence electrons to a higher energy region. Since the amount of energy required for excitation differs for each halogen, each halogen displays a different colour.
